Air Travel Air travel has revolutionized the way people move around the world, making long-distance journeys faster and more accessible. Over the past century, the aviation industry has expanded significantly, with advancements in technology leading to safer and more efficient flights. Airlines now operate globally, connecting major cities and remote destinations alike. Despite its many benefits, air travel has some drawbacks. One major concern is its environmental impact, as airplanes contribute significantly to carbon emissions. Additionally, flight delays, security screenings, and cramped seating conditions can make the travel experience stressful for passengers. However, many airlines and researchers are working on solutions to reduce emissions and improve passenger comfort. Another important aspect of air travel is its role in international business and tourism. Business professionals rely on flights to attend meetings, sign contracts, and establish global connections. At the same time, tourism has flourished due to the affordability and
convenience of air travel, allowing people to explore new cultures and destinations more easily. Looking ahead, the future of air travel is likely to include advancements in fuel efficiency, electric or hybrid aircraft, and improved airport services. With ongoing research and investment, the aviation industry aims to create a more sustainable and enjoyable travel experience for passengers worldwide. Multiple-Choice Questions 26.
